Task

Select a patient you have cared for who is mechanically ventilated and haemodynamically monitored. Identify two major therapeutic nursing or medical interventions and for each intervention address the following:

  1. Identify the relevant clinical assessment data and critically analyse your interpretation of this data.

  2. Critically analyse the rationale for the patient care intervention and the impact this intervention has had on the patient.

Step 5: Explaining Rationale

For each intervention, the student was taught to critically link the abnormal findings to the treatment given. Examples:

  • Fluid resuscitation → low BP and MAP indicated hypovolemia, justifying albumin infusion.

  • Sedation/ventilation → patient on SIMV PRVC mode with high FiO₂ requirements; sedation was necessary to synchronise with ventilator and reduce oxygen demand.
